PETA Nominates UFC Vets Shields, Corassani, Danzig for Sexiest Vegetarian Celebrity of 2013
By: Sherdog.com Staff
Like most professional mixed martial artists, Jake Shields, Akira Corassani and Mac Danzig adhere to strict diets when training.
By eating plant-based fare alone, the trio of UFC veterans has been nominated for Sexiest Vegetarian Celebrity of 2013 by peta2, the youth division of People for the Ethical Treatment of Animals. The full list of nominees, which includes the likes of Anne Hathaway, Kristen Wiig, Jared Leto and Russell Brand, can be viewed here.
Voting for the contest ends on Aug. 16, and one male and one female winner will be announced on Aug. 19.
Danzig last competed at UFC on Fox 8, losing to Melvin Guillard via second-round knockout in a lightweight affair. Corassani was expected to face Mike Thomas Brown at UFC’s inaugural Fox Sports 1 card in Boston before an injury forced him to withdraw from the bout. Shields, meanwhile, is rumored to face Demian Maia on an upcoming UFC card in 2013. The former Strikeforce champion also appears in peta2’s online game, Cage Fight: Knock Out Animal Abuse.

Mac Danzig: No Trainer Comes Close to Rico Chiapparelli
By: Sherdog.com Staff
Mac Danzig, on “Cheap Seats,” discussing trainer Rico Chiapparelli:
Read more
“I will say without a doubt that he’s probably the only genius that I actually know. That doesn’t mean he’s like a brilliant mind that could take apart your engine and put it back together, but as far as fighting goes, as far as this specific thing goes, fighting, body mechanics, positioning, understanding combat and all forms of it, just really understanding MMA and wrestling and submissions, the guy is like no other. Nobody even comes close, and I’ve worked with a lot of people over the years.” -

UFC 115’s Most Memorable Moments
Mirko "Cro Cop" File Photo: Sherdog.com
The vast majority of fans thought UFC 115 would be a garbage night of fights. Instead we got a night full of tension, drama and violence that made picking just five moments worthy of recognition near impossible.
Here comes my best shot.
Franklin Starches Liddell … with a Broken Arm
Chuck Liddell was starting to come alive, and Rich Franklin was not enjoying the punches crashing into his notoriously fragile chin.
Further complicating matters for Franklin was his left arm, which he later revealed to be broken and was severely altering his offensive output. As he has so many times in his career, Liddell smelled blood and wasn’t about to let Franklin make it to the second round.
Liddell’s trademark blitzkrieg ended with Franklin landing a crunching, compact right on his chin and putting “The Iceman” down and out in gut-wrenching fashion. It was a moment that perfectly synthesized the athletic brilliance of mixed martial artists and the brutal consequences that come with their job description.
Cro Cop Brings Back the Cemetery
Patrick Barry dropped Mirko Filipovic twice in the first round and was on the verge of turning his lead leg into mush. Even the most fervent “Cro Cop” fan had to know that this might be his last stand.
Then something happened that I never thought I would get to see again: Filipovic threw his left high kick of doom, and it changed the fight without even landing. Shades of the Filipovic of old followed, as he started using his underrated boxing skills all the while whipping that left leg with the reckless abandon his fans have been begging for.
“Right leg, hospital. Left leg, cemetery.” It’s the greatest tagline in MMA history for a reason, folks. Read more
